Abstract

There are a number of widely used texturing techniques, as etching, electrical discharge and abrasive blasting (sandblasting) which combine quality and optimised processing time. The process allows the ablation, fusion and/or vaporization, and finally substrate texturing in only one step by means of a concentrated energy bean in a focused spot.A pulsed Nd:YAG laser (1.064 μm radiation, 120 ns) with repetitive scans has been used to texture aluminium AL 2017 substrates. During the process, several laser parameters as scanning rate, distance between the laser impacts, frequency of the impulses and incident power have been studied to achieve NiAl coatings.Optical and scanning electron microscopy, and optical 3D profilometry were used to characterize the surface texture. Mechanical testing allowed evaluating the toughness and adhesion of the deposit.Surface texturing inducing holes on the substrate surface, coating adherence produced by thermal spraying mainly depends on the geometry of the texture (depth and diameter of holes) as well as on the distribution throughout the treated surface.
